Who Created Rolex? The Hans Wilsdorf Legacy

The answer to "who started Rolex?" is unequivocally Hans Wilsdorf. While he didn't single-handedly craft every watch, his vision, entrepreneurial spirit, and relentless pursuit of excellence were the driving forces behind Rolex's inception and phenomenal growth. Born in Bavaria in 1881, Wilsdorf's journey to becoming the founder of one of the world's most recognizable brands was anything but straightforward. He began his career in the watchmaking industry in La Chaux-de-Fonds, Switzerland, a region renowned for its horological expertise. Even at a young age, Wilsdorf recognized the potential for a wristwatch that transcended mere timekeeping; he envisioned a timepiece that would be both accurate and elegant, a status symbol for the discerning individual.

Wilsdorf's early career involved working for various watch companies, allowing him to gain invaluable experience and knowledge of the industry. He quickly grasped the limitations of existing wristwatches, which were often unreliable and lacked the precision he sought. This understanding fueled his ambition to create something better, something that would redefine the standards of wristwatch craftsmanship. Crucially, he recognized the importance of branding and marketing, a foresight that would prove instrumental in the future success of Rolex.

In 1905, at the age of 24, Wilsdorf established his own company, Wilsdorf & Davis, in London, partnering with Alfred Davis. This partnership focused on importing high-quality Swiss movements and assembling them into stylish cases, marking the initial steps towards the Rolex brand. However, the name "Rolex" didn't appear immediately. The name itself is shrouded in some mystery, with several theories proposed for its origin. Some suggest it is a combination of "Role" (referencing the role of the watch) and "ex" (short for excellent), while others speculate on a more arbitrary choice, emphasizing the smooth, flowing sound of the name. Whatever its origin, the name "Rolex" would become synonymous with luxury and precision.

What Year Was Rolex Founded? The Birth of a Legend

While Wilsdorf & Davis was established in 1905, the official registration of the Rolex trademark occurred in 1908. This date is often cited as the year of Rolex's founding, although the company's evolution continued for several years before achieving its definitive form. The trademark registration marks a significant milestone, signifying Wilsdorf's commitment to building a distinct brand identity separate from his initial partnership.
